Bungie Sign 10 Year Publishing Contract With Activision
As a lot of you may know, Activision have run into some troubles revolving around Infinity Ward, to the point where it's gotten so bad that of their employees have defected and Infinity Ward may now end up closing down. However, the gap left by them may have now been filled, as they've announced a publishing contract with Bungie, most famous for being the developers of the incredibly successful Halo Franchise for the Xbox and Xbox 360. Bungie, although splitting from Microsoft back in 2007, have been currently working on Halo Reach for the Xbox 360, which they've confirmed will be their last Halo game, although the series will continue.
However, it also appears that they've been working on other projects as well, with Activision stating that the contract deal will give them exclusive worldwide rights to bring "Bungie's next big action game universe to market”. Right now, there are very few details regarding this game. But what is known is that the game will be multiplatform, with Activision's publishing deal allowing them to distribute games for Bungie's new franchise across "multiple platforms and devices”. However, Bungie will have full ownership over the rights to their new franchise, and will remain an independent studio. It is not completely known however, whether the deal applies to just this new game or every Bungie game made after Halo Reach.
Regarding the deal, Activision COO Thomas Tippi has said “Bungie is one of the premier studios in our industry and we are extremely pleased to have the opportunity to work with their talented team over the next decade.". Microsoft has released this statement regarding the deal “Our partnership with Bungie as a first-party developer for Xbox 360 remains unchanged, and right now we're deeply engaged with them on the development of Halo: Reach, which is poised to be the biggest game of 2010."
Expect more details regarding the deal in the near future.
